Visa mer WebbTo convert a temperature in Fahrenheit to Celsius, subtract 32 from the Fahrenheit temperature and multiply that number by 0.555. To convert a temperature in Celsius to Fahrenheit, multiply 1.8 by the Celsius temperature and then add 32 to that number. The Celsius scale has 100 degrees between … Webb7 apr. 2024 · To convert temperatures of these in degrees Fahrenheit to Celsius, we need to subtract 32 and multiply by 0.5556 or we can say 5/9 also. For Example: (50°F - 32) x 0.5556 = 10°C. Webb29 sep. 2024 · This worked example problem demonstrates how to convert Fahrenheit measurements to the Celsius and Kelvin temperature scales. Problem Express normal body temperature, 98.6°F, in °C and K. WebbCelsius to Fahrenheit: °C × 1.8 + 32 = °F Fahrenheit to Celsius: (°F − 32) / 1.8 = °C To make "×1.8" easier we can multiply by 2 and subtract 10%, but it only works for °C to °F: Celsius to Fahrenheit: (°C × 2) less 10% + 32 = °F …

Webb18 juli 2024 · C = 5/9 x (F - 32) As noted, your starting temperature is 98.6 F. So you would have: C = 5/9 x (F - 32) C = 5/9 x (98.6 - 32) C = 5/9 x (66.6) C = 37 C. One Celsius degree is an interval of 1 K, and zero degrees Celsius … china rf pcb design software pricelistA temperature setpoint is the level at which the body attempts to maintain its temperature. When the setpoint is raised, the result is a fever. Most fevers are caused by infectious disease and can be lowered, if desired, with antipyretic medications.
